Linux Kernel  3.7.1
 All Data Structures Namespaces Files Functions Variables Typedefs Enumerations Enumerator Macros Groups Pages
Macros | Functions
dpi.c File Reference
#include <linux/kernel.h>
#include <linux/delay.h>
#include <linux/export.h>
#include <linux/err.h>
#include <linux/errno.h>
#include <linux/platform_device.h>
#include <linux/regulator/consumer.h>
#include <linux/string.h>
#include <video/omapdss.h>
#include "dss.h"
#include "dss_features.h"

Go to the source code of this file.

Macros

#define DSS_SUBSYS_NAME   "DPI"
 

Functions

int omapdss_dpi_display_enable (struct omap_dss_device *dssdev)
 
 EXPORT_SYMBOL (omapdss_dpi_display_enable)
 
void omapdss_dpi_display_disable (struct omap_dss_device *dssdev)
 
 EXPORT_SYMBOL (omapdss_dpi_display_disable)
 
void omapdss_dpi_set_timings (struct omap_dss_device *dssdev, struct omap_video_timings *timings)
 
 EXPORT_SYMBOL (omapdss_dpi_set_timings)
 
int dpi_check_timings (struct omap_dss_device *dssdev, struct omap_video_timings *timings)
 
 EXPORT_SYMBOL (dpi_check_timings)
 
void omapdss_dpi_set_data_lines (struct omap_dss_device *dssdev, int data_lines)
 
 EXPORT_SYMBOL (omapdss_dpi_set_data_lines)
 
int __init dpi_init_platform_driver (void)
 
void __exit dpi_uninit_platform_driver (void)
 

Macro Definition Documentation

#define DSS_SUBSYS_NAME   "DPI"

Definition at line 23 of file dpi.c.

Function Documentation

int dpi_check_timings ( struct omap_dss_device dssdev,
struct omap_video_timings timings 
)

Definition at line 304 of file dpi.c.

int __init dpi_init_platform_driver ( void  )

Definition at line 495 of file dpi.c.

void __exit dpi_uninit_platform_driver ( void  )

Definition at line 500 of file dpi.c.

EXPORT_SYMBOL ( omapdss_dpi_display_enable  )
EXPORT_SYMBOL ( omapdss_dpi_display_disable  )
EXPORT_SYMBOL ( omapdss_dpi_set_timings  )
EXPORT_SYMBOL ( dpi_check_timings  )
EXPORT_SYMBOL ( omapdss_dpi_set_data_lines  )
void omapdss_dpi_display_disable ( struct omap_dss_device dssdev)

Definition at line 266 of file dpi.c.

int omapdss_dpi_display_enable ( struct omap_dss_device dssdev)

Definition at line 178 of file dpi.c.

void omapdss_dpi_set_data_lines ( struct omap_dss_device dssdev,
int  data_lines 
)

Definition at line 352 of file dpi.c.

void omapdss_dpi_set_timings ( struct omap_dss_device dssdev,
struct omap_video_timings timings 
)

Definition at line 291 of file dpi.c.

Variable Documentation

int data_lines

Definition at line 47 of file dpi.c.

Definition at line 41 of file dpi.c.

struct mutex lock

Definition at line 43 of file dpi.c.

Definition at line 46 of file dpi.c.

Definition at line 49 of file dpi.c.

Definition at line 45 of file dpi.c.

struct regulator* vdds_dsi_reg

Definition at line 40 of file dpi.c.